Description
The Discover V BTE is a fully digital Behind-The-Ear (BTE) hearing instrument developed to set a new standard for affordable and fundamental hearing care. The instrument offers a two band signal processing with Advopro Digital, which suppresses dirsturbances caused by the user’s own voice and at the same time maintains amplifi cation of the frequencies important for understanding speech. The clear sound, reliable design, easy battery change, long battery lifetime and low battery warning indicator is all standard.
Discover V is available in beige, brown and grey colors. No battery is required during programming - power is supplied via prog. cable CS45. Battery type 13. Estimated average battery life 217 hours.
Key features :
4-band Wide Dynamic Range Compression (WDRC).
4-band shaping handles.
Feedback Management via Notch fi lter.
Long battery lifetime.
User-friendly design.
Audiogram + fi tting rule.
Digital Noise Clarifi er.
Clear, more comfortable sound.
For moderate to severe hearing loss.
Standard confi guration :
Volume control.
Telecoil.
Acoustic indicator for programme selection.
Low battery warning indicator.
Fitting requirements :
HI-PRO™ or NOAHLink™ interface.
NOAH software™ (2.x or 3.x).
Aventa™ fi tting software (1.5 or higher).
CS45 socket programming cables.

Typical performance data - IEC 118-7
No battery is required during programming - power is supplied via prog. cable CS45
Data in accordance with IEC 118-7. All sound pressure levels (dB SPL) refer to 20 μPa.
Unless otherwise is stated, data are based on a battery voltage of 1.35 V and impedance of 5 Ohm.
Tolerance Unit
Reference test gain (60 dB SPL input) at 1600 Hz 37 +/- 5 dB
Full-on gain (50 dB SPL input) Max. 57 +/- 5 dB
at 1600 Hz 47 +/- 5 dB
Maximum output (90 dB SPL input) Max. 126 +/- 4 dB SPL
at 1600 Hz 120 +/- 4 dB SPL
Total harmonic distortion at 800 Hz 0.5 +3 %
at 1600 Hz 0.3 +3 %
Telecoil sensitivity (1 mA/m input) Max. 88 +/- 6 dB SPL
Telecoil sensitivity (10 mA/m input) Max. 108 +/- 6 dB SPL
Equivalent input Noise w/o Noise reduction 25 +3 dB SPL
Frequency range (DIN 45605) 160-6000 Hz
Current drain 1.2 +20% mA
Typical Battery Life Time Battery type 13 217 hrs

Microphone complete
Solder the wires as shown. The wires should slope 45
o.
Brush coating CH-8
- p/n 75925421 - onto the solder points
Mic. without wires and suspension: p/n 75927771
Red ESW wire, 10 mm. p/n 15129610 Amber ESW wire, 10 mm. p/n 15129710 Green ESW wire, 10 mm. p/n 15129810
Mount the mic. into the mic. suspension, p/n 31932216 (50 pcs.)
Mic. complete mounted with wires and suspension, p/n 15248800
Notice: Before mounting mic. complete into the sound inlet groove in the housing, add Vaseline p/n 15255601 to the groove

Receiver complete
Mount the rec tube, p/n 31932254/50 pcs.) in an angle of 23
o
as shown. Add a drop of Loctite 406 (p/n 1901-339) each side to fi x it. Glue with CH-71 (p/n
75925336) around tube to make it tight to the sound outlet of the rec
Add Loctite 406 on both inner sides of the metal shield before mount­ing it on the rec. Make sure the lower side of the shield is mounted to the edge of the rec (indicated by a red dotted line). Mount the suspen­sion (p/n 70911569) as shown and glue a bit with CH-8 (p/n 75925421) to keep the suspension in place onto the shield/rec
Gently bend the wires and fi x them to the rec case by using CH-8. Rec complete mounted with wires, suspension, tube and shield p/n 15248900
Before mounting the tube into the stud/sound outlet, add Vaseline p/n 15255601 round the tube on the area which is not to be cut off

Amplifi er
When replacing the switch p/n 70927017, cut the two terminals as shown
Mount the sw supp on the sw board. Mount the switch and bend the terminals onto the soldering points
Solder the terminals and apply CH-6 p/n 75925308 in the 2 holes
Apply Coat p/n 1908-209 as indicated in pictures 4-5.
The switch complete mounted (as shown in pic. 3) is also available as p/n
15287500. How to replace: Disconnect the sw board wing and the points which con­nect the sw board to the main board. Lift up the defective part and place the new one into the housing. Connect the new sw board to the main board and the sw board wing to the bat spring (+)

Prepare Amplifi er for mounting into Housing
Solder the 3 mic. wires to the PCB. Gently adjust the wires and make sure the wires are placed correct round the screw hole in housing (see also next page). Add CH-8 on the solder points
Solder the 2 rec wires to the PCB. Gently adjust the wires and add CH-8 on the solder points, in the notch and on rec case to fi x the wires
Fill the area between the nylon insert and the switch-PCB with grease p/n 6879-199. Do not cover the bolts and the areas which will be visible from outside (indicated with blue color)
Solder the green wire from battery spring (-) to the PCB. Solder the switch board “wing” to the battery spring (+) and apply CH-8 on both points
Insert bolts p/n 75921693 (see next picture).Fix the battery springs into the partition and solder the green solid wire (p/n 70927136) to battery spring (-) (yellow arrow). Apply CH-8 p/n 75925421 on the solder point
Place partition complete into lower housing.Add coat p/n 1908-209 on the lower area of the partition as indicated with blue color
